Located in the Atlanta Public Schools at 65 Rogers St NE in Atlanta, GA, Toomer Elementary School serves grades PK-5 and has an enrollment of roughly 218 students. Frequently Asked Questions about Atlanta
How much are Studio apartments in Atlanta?
There are currently 1,027 Studio Apartments in Atlanta with rent ranges from $684 to $5,107 with an average price of $1,652.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Atlanta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Atlanta ranges from $200 to $10,091 with an average monthly rent of $1,745.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Atlanta c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Atlanta range from $825 to $15,950.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,151.
How expensive are Atlanta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,050 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Atlanta on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$830 to $19,085 - averaging $2,438 for the location.
